互联网上有一些关于这方面的讨论(特别是关于堆栈溢出),但其中很多都是从2015年左右开始的,所以我想知道是否有人有近期的经验.
我们使用JavaScript小部件为Web表单上的预先键入搜索功能提供支持,但此UI始终与Chrome自动填充重叠.
虽然autocomplete=“off”用来工作,Chrome浏览器现在似乎忽略这个值了,反正显示的UI.我唯一可以找到适用于OSX上的Chrome 66/67的是无效值,例如autocomplete=“blah”.这看起来似乎过于粗略,我们之前已经对此进行过实验,在某些情况下/ Chrome版本会被忽略.
有没有人喜欢使用HTML/Javascript关闭它的可靠方法?
作为旁注 - 看起来甚至Google也无法在需要时将其关闭,因为他们自己的谷歌地图预先输入小部件被Chrome自动填充覆盖.这可以在大多数Shopify商店看到.
我刚刚Tensorflow Toxicity classifier从这个Github 页面的示例中加载了样板代码。
这是代码index.js-
const toxicity = require('@tensorflow-models/toxicity');
const threshold = 0.9;
toxicity.load(threshold).then((model) => {
const sentences = ['you suck'];
model.classify(sentences).then((predictions) => {
console.log(predictions);
});
});
Run Code Online (Sandbox Code Playgroud)
如果你需要完整的项目,这里是GitHub repo。
但是当我运行代码时,它给了我以下错误 -
(node:2180) UnhandledPromiseRejectionWarning: FetchError: request to https://storage.googleapis.com/tfjs-models/savedmodel/universal_sentence_encoder/vocab.json failed, reason: Client network socket disconnected before secure TLS connection was established
at ClientRequest.<anonymous> (D:\xampp\htdocs\nodejs-projects\simple-node\node_modules\node-fetch\lib\index.js:1393:11)
at ClientRequest.emit (events.js:310:20)
at TLSSocket.socketErrorListener (_http_client.js:426:9)
at TLSSocket.emit (events.js:310:20)
at emitErrorNT (internal/streams/destroy.js:92:8)
at emitErrorAndCloseNT (internal/streams/destroy.js:60:3)
at processTicksAndRejections (internal/process/task_queues.js:84:21)
(node:2180) UnhandledPromiseRejectionWarning: …Run Code Online (Sandbox Code Playgroud) 我正在尝试在 React 应用程序中安装 Service Worker。但是当我尝试注册它时,它失败了:
Uncaught (in promise) TypeError: Failed to register a ServiceWorker: ServiceWorker 脚本评估失败
我的代码在 App.js 中,其中的代码是:
import React, { Component } from 'react';
class App extends Component {
constructor(){
if ('serviceWorker' in navigator) {
window.addEventListener('load', () => {
navigator.serviceWorker.register('./sw.js')})}
}
render() {
return (
<div className="App">
<h1>PWA Go!</h1>
</div>
);
}
}
Run Code Online (Sandbox Code Playgroud)
此外,我的所有文件都在 src 文件夹中。这些文件是:
索引.js
应用程序.js
离线.html
sw.js
我的 service worker(sw.js) 里面有这个代码:
this.addEventListner(`install`, (e) => {
e.waitUntil(
caches.open(`V1`)
.then((ref) => {
ref.add(`offline.html`)
})
.catch((err) => { …Run Code Online (Sandbox Code Playgroud) 我试图用create-react-app-typescript创建一家商店。一切都很好.....但是,此错误发生了,“参数'props'隐式具有'any'类型”,我在互联网上找到了解决方案...建议为props创建一个接口。但是我真的不知道那个物体有什么,所以我什至不能做...
任何帮助表示赞赏!(我是TypeScript的新手)
import * as React from 'react';
import { connect } from "react-redux";
import mapStateToProps from "./utilities/mapStateToProp";
class App extends React.Component {
constructor(props){
super(props);
}
public render() {
return (
<div className="App">
<h1>Go Type React</h1>
</div>
);
}
}
export default connect(mapStateToProps)(App);
Run Code Online (Sandbox Code Playgroud) 我想用某种动画删除该行.问题是当我将宽度设置为0然后它也改变了它的位置.这不应该发生.
该线应从起点移动到终点而不改变其位置.
$('button').click(function(){
$('.main').toggleClass('remove')
})Run Code Online (Sandbox Code Playgroud)
.line{
width:60px;
height:2px;
background:#000;
transform: rotate(30deg);
position:absolute;
top:20px;
z-index:1;
transition: all 0.3s ease-in-out;
}
.remove .line{
width:0
}
.main{
position:relative;
}
span{
display:inline-block;
width:40px;
height:40px;
background:red;
border-radius:50%;
position:relative;
left:8px;
top:2px
}
button{
margin-top:60px
}Run Code Online (Sandbox Code Playgroud)
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<div class="main">
<div class="line"></div>
<span></span>
</div>
<button>toggle</button>Run Code Online (Sandbox Code Playgroud)
我正在为我的应用程序编写一个服务工作者,它在“激活”状态下读取和写入 IndexedDB。为了在 IndexedDB 中读取或写入,我使用一个名为“idb”的库(https://unpkg.com/idb?module)。有没有可能的方法在服务工作者中导入库。另外,该库使用 ES6 导入和导出,这会有问题吗?
javascript ×4
html ×2
css ×1
fetch ×1
jquery ×1
node.js ×1
promise ×1
reactjs ×1
redux ×1
tensorflow ×1
typescript ×1